Nice weather info – Weather & Radar USA Pro Review

I love the radar shows everything that’s going on around me so I know well in advance. Give me the temperatures and future whether
Review by jonnycakes 20 on Weather & Radar USA Pro.

All Weather & Radar USA Pro Reviews


Other Reviews